Brad Pitt recently shared his excitement about his upcoming film, F1, during a press conference in Mexico City. He revealed that he’s been eager to star in a racing film for decades, but the opportunity never materialized until now. Pitt expressed that the experience of being immersed in the actual Formula One season, as envisioned by director Joseph Kosinski, was a dream come true. He described the process as unlike anything he’s experienced in his extensive career.
In F1, Pitt portrays Sonny Hayes, a former Formula One driver who returns to the sport to revive a struggling team. He is joined by rookie teammate Joshua Pearce, played by Damson Idris. Idris praised Pitt’s mentorship, noting their seamless dynamic both on and off set. The film also stars Javier Bardem, Kerry Condon, and Tobias Menzies.
Directed by Joseph Kosinski and produced by Jerry Bruckheimer, F1 was filmed in collaboration with the Federation Internationale de l’Automobile (FIA) and features real F1 environments. The film is set to be released in theaters on June 27, 2025.
